JS实现获取当前URL和来源URL的方法


Posted in Javascript onAugust 24, 2016

本文实例讲述了JS实现获取当前URL和来源URL的方法。分享给大家供大家参考,具体如下:

index.html:

<!DOCTYPE html>
<html lang="zh-cn">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1,maximum-scale=1, user-scalable=no">
<title>新建H5模板</title>
</head>
<body>
<a href="demo.html">链接</a>
</body>
</html>

demo.html:

<!DOCTYPE html>
<html lang="zh-cn">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1,maximum-scale=1, user-scalable=no">
<title>新建H5模板</title>
</head>
<body>
当前URL:<input type="text" style=" width:300px;" name="nowurl" id="nowurl"><br>
来源URL:<input type="text" style=" width:300px;" name="fromurl" id="fromurl">
<script>
  var nowurl = document.URL;
  var fromurl = document.referrer;
  document.getElementById('nowurl').value = nowurl;
  document.getElementById('fromurl').value = fromurl;
</script>
</body>
</html>

效果图:

假设是通过 https://3water.com/index.html 进来

JS实现获取当前URL和来源URL的方法

那么:

获取当前的URL是:https://3water.com/demo.html
获取来源的URL是:https://3water.com/index.html

JS实现获取当前URL和来源URL的方法

说明:

document.URL 属性可返回当前文档的 URL。
document.referrer 属性可返回载入当前文档的文档的 URL。

希望本文所述对大家JavaScript程序设计有所帮助。

Javascript 相关文章推荐
JS验证身份证有效性示例
Oct 11 Javascript
js中cookie的添加、取值、删除示例代码
Oct 21 Javascript
node.js中的querystring.escape方法使用说明
Dec 10 Javascript
jQuery实现DIV层淡入淡出拖动特效的方法
Feb 13 Javascript
微信小程序 scroll-view实现上拉加载与下拉刷新的实例
Jan 21 Javascript
vue-cli如何快速构建vue项目
Apr 26 Javascript
Bootstrap弹出框之自定义悬停框标题、内容和样式示例代码
Jul 11 Javascript
ES6知识点整理之Proxy的应用实例详解
Apr 16 Javascript
解决 viewer.js 动态更新图片导致无法预览的问题
May 14 Javascript
通过说明与示例了解js五种设计模式
Jun 17 Javascript
微信小程序 数据缓存实现方法详解
Aug 26 Javascript
jQuery中getJSON跨域原理的深入讲解
Sep 02 jQuery
Bootstrap和Angularjs配合自制弹框的实例代码
Aug 24 #Javascript
总结Javascript中的隐式类型转换
Aug 24 #Javascript
jQuery实现的自适应焦点图效果完整实例
Aug 24 #Javascript
BootStrap+Angularjs+NgDialog实现模式对话框
Aug 24 #Javascript
JS for...in 遍历语句用法实例分析
Aug 24 #Javascript
用JS中split方法实现彩色文字背景效果实例
Aug 24 #Javascript
BootStrap table表格插件自适应固定表头(超好用)
Aug 24 #Javascript
You might like
mysql中存储过程、函数的一些问题
2007/02/14 PHP
dedecms系统的广告设置代码 基础版本
2010/04/09 PHP
PHP伪造来源HTTP_REFERER的方法实例详解
2015/07/06 PHP
php中session_id()函数详细介绍,会话id生成过程及session id长度
2015/09/23 PHP
php实现概率性随机抽奖代码
2016/01/02 PHP
PHPStorm+XDebug进行调试图文教程
2016/06/13 PHP
js每次Title显示不同的名言
2008/09/25 Javascript
javascript客户端遍历控件与获取父容器对象示例代码
2014/01/06 Javascript
jquery mobile的触控点击事件会多次触发问题的解决方法
2014/05/08 Javascript
ECMAScript中函数function类型
2015/06/03 Javascript
jQuery遍历json的方法(推荐)
2016/06/12 Javascript
AngularJS ui-router (嵌套路由)实例
2017/03/10 Javascript
vue router使用query和params传参的使用和区别
2017/11/13 Javascript
Vue+jquery实现表格指定列的文字收缩的示例代码
2018/01/09 jQuery
vue一个页面实现音乐播放器的示例
2018/02/06 Javascript
微信小程序 wx.getUserInfo引导用户授权问题实例分析
2020/03/09 Javascript
[01:19:11]Ti4 循环赛第二日 NaVi.us vs iG
2014/07/11 DOTA
[54:06]OG vs TNC 2018国际邀请赛小组赛BO2 第二场 8.19
2018/08/21 DOTA
Django中模型Model添加JSON类型字段的方法
2015/06/17 Python
Python生成数字图片代码分享
2017/10/31 Python
pycharm修改界面主题颜色的方法
2019/01/17 Python
Python 20行简单实现有道在线翻译的详解
2019/05/15 Python
python判断文件夹内是否存在指定后缀文件的实例
2019/06/10 Python
基于python实现的百度音乐下载器python pyqt改进版(附代码)
2019/08/05 Python
pygame库实现移动底座弹球小游戏
2020/04/14 Python
解决pycharm 安装numpy失败的问题
2019/12/05 Python
python3实现在二叉树中找出和为某一值的所有路径(推荐)
2019/12/26 Python
CSS3基础(RGBa、text-shadow、box-shadow、border-radius)
2012/11/13 HTML / CSS
css3 实现元素弧线运动的示例代码
2020/04/24 HTML / CSS
如何用Java判断一个文件或目录是否存在
2012/11/19 面试题
卫校护理专业毕业生求职信
2013/11/26 职场文书
党校学习思想汇报
2014/01/06 职场文书
宣传保护环境的公益广告词
2014/03/13 职场文书
清洁工个人总结
2015/03/04 职场文书
施工员岗位职责范本
2015/04/11 职场文书
基于Pygame实现简单的贪吃蛇游戏
2021/12/06 Python